Android Jackpot Sweepstakes App Development

Заказчик: AI | Опубликовано: 22.01.2026
Бюджет: 750 $

Freelancer Proposal: Jackpot Lottery Sweepstakes App (Android) Project Overview I am seeking an experienced Flutter developer to build a mobile Android app for a lottery-style sweepstakes game called “Jackpot Lottery Sweepstakes”. The app will allow users to: Sign in with Google account Watch rewarded video ads to earn credits Pick 10 numbers from 1–100 Submit picks for a random draw (server-side RNG) Earn credits for matching numbers, and cash out credits Compete for a $1,000,000 jackpot (insured) Track user location for eligibility and fraud prevention The app must be secure, compliant with Google Play policies, and resistant to manipulation. Key Features 1. User Authentication Google Sign-In via Firebase Auth Unique user identification Anti-fraud measures 2. Lottery Mechanics Users pick 10 numbers (1–100) Server-side draw of 10 random numbers Credits awarded per matched number Jackpot awarded for 10/10 matches (insured) Odds displayed in-app 3. Credits System Credits earned via: Watching ads (1 credit/ad) Lottery matches (1 credit per correct number) Credits can be cashed out once minimum threshold reached Server-side tracking only (prevent tampering) Manual verification of payouts 4. Rewarded Video Ads AdMob integration Must be Google Play compliant Credits granted for ad completion 5. Cash-Out System Credits have micro-value (e.g., 1 credit = $0.001) Minimum cash-out: $5 Payout via PayPal or gift cards Server-side tracking and anti-fraud measures Manual review required 6. Location & Security Capture user location via GPS for fraud prevention Anti-manipulation: Server-side RNG Firebase App Check Rate-limiting entries and ad credits Backend Requirements Firebase (Auth, Firestore, Cloud Functions) Server-side RNG and credit tracking Cash-out handling function Security rules to prevent hacking Logs for jackpot verification Design Requirements Simple, mobile-friendly UI Responsive number picker (1–100) Credit display Ad button Submit lottery numbers button Jackpot and result notifications Technical Requirements Flutter (Android only) Firebase backend AdMob rewarded ads Geolocator for location capture Server-side Cloud Functions for RNG and cash-out Well-documented code with setup instructions Compatible with latest Android SDK and Google Play policies Deliverables Flutter Android project with working app Firebase setup instructions and Cloud Functions Integrated AdMob rewarded ads Fully functional credit and cash-out system Tested anti-fraud / anti-cheat system User guide and maintenance instructions Optional Add-Ons (Bonus) Referral system Analytics integration (Firebase Analytics) Leaderboard Freelancer Requirements Proven experience with Flutter + Firebase apps Experience integrating AdMob rewarded ads Experience building secure sweepstakes or lottery apps Knowledge of Google Play policies for sweepstakes and ad-based apps Good communication skills and ability to deliver on schedule Timeline & Budget Timeline: 6–10 weeks (can be negotiated based on experience) Authentication + basic lottery UI Server-side RNG and draw logic Ad integration + credit system Cash-out system + anti-fraud Final testing & delivery Proposal Instructions Provide examples of previous Flutter/Firebase apps, preferably with lottery, sweepstakes, or ad integration experience Include your estimated timeline and cost Brief description of your approach to prevent cheating / fraud Include any suggestions to improve app security or monetization